Langley Raptors arrive in Japan
June 12, 2009
LANGLEY AIR FORCE BASE, Va.  -- Lt. Col. Adrian Spain, 94th Fighter Squadron commander, shakes hands with Airman 1st Class Brendan Carroll, 94th Aircraft Maintenance Unit crew chief, before doing dissimilar training in the F-22A Raptor at Kadena Air Base, Japan, June 6. More than 280 Airmen from the 94th Fighter Squadron, Virginia Air National Guard 192nd Fighter Wing, and 94th Aircraft Maintenance Unit deployed to Kadena as part of a Western Pacific theater security package May 26. (U.S. Air Force photo/Airman 1st Class Jarrod Chavana)

Langley pilot takes MC-12 to first combat mission
June 11, 2009
Lt. Col. Phillip Stewart conducts a preflight inspection of an MC-12 Liberty prior to the aircraft's first combat sortie June 10 at Joint Base Balad, Iraq. A native of Silver Spring, Md., Colonel Stewart is the 362nd Expeditionary Reconnaissance Squadron commander and deployed from Langley Air Force Base, Va. (U.S. Air Force photo/Senior Airman Tiffany Trojca)

480th ISR Wing wins Best Single-Person History Office for 2009
June 3, 2009
Mr. Rick Griset, wing historian for the 480th Intelligence, Surveillance and Reconnaissance Wing, receives the Air Force History and Museum Program’s 2009 Allan S. Major award from Gen. Norton Schwartz at a ceremony held at the National Museum of the Air Force May 13.  The award recognizes the Air Force’s best single-person history office. (Courtesy photo)
